FSCA

Financial Sector Conduct Authority (South Africa)

ProperFX is authorized and regulated as a Financial Service Provider (FSP) from the Financial Sector Conduct Authority (FSCA) in South Africa, under the licence number 49045

FSCA is an independent institution established by statute to oversee the South African non-banking financial services industry. It regulates the Johannesburg Stock Exchange (JSE), the largest exchange in the African continent.

What is the difference between a regulated broker and an unregulated broker?

The main difference between a regulated broker and an unregulated broker lies in the oversight and compliance with legal and financial standards required by governmental or independent authorities.

A regulated broker is licensed to operate within a specific jurisdiction, or from a country with which there is a mutual regulatory agreement, ensuring the broker is adhering to a set of predefined rules, laws, and protection measures for traders and investors. This licensing shows that a recognized regulator is monitoring the broker's activities to make sure the broker follows fair trading practices.
